一氧化氮与人类脐血管:药理学及免疫组织化学研究

Nitric oxide and human umbilical vessels: pharmacological and immunohistochemical studies.

作者信息

Sexton A J, Loesch A, Turmaine M, Miah S, Burnstock G

机构信息

Department of Anatomy and Developmental Biology, University College London, UK.

出版信息

Placenta. 1995 Apr;16(3):277-88. doi: 10.1016/0143-4004(95)90114-0.

DOI:10.1016/0143-4004(95)90114-0
PMID:7638109
Abstract

Human umbilical vessels are devoid of nerves and therefore endothelial cells may play an important role in the control of fetoplacental blood flow. In this study we examined the pharmacological effects of various substances, known to produce endothelial-mediated vasodilation in many blood vessels, on the human umbilical artery and vein from legal terminations [mean gestational age, 15 (8-17) weeks; n = 12] and normal term vaginal deliveries [mean gestational age, 39 (38-41) weeks; n = 12]. Acetylcholine, adenosine 5'-triphosphate, the calcium ionophore A23187 and substance P had no effect on raised vascular tone, whereas sodium nitroprusside relaxed 5-hydroxytryptamine (5-HT) preconstricted, umbilical artery and vein from both early and late pregnancy. L-NG-Nitroarginine methyl ester (L-NAME) had no effect on basal tone or on high tone, after it was raised by 5-HT. Localization of nitric oxide synthase [NOS, type I (neuronal)] was examined in the same umbilical vessels using electron immunocytochemistry. No NOS-immunoreactive endothelial cells were observed in the umbilical vessels taken during early pregnancy. However, the percentage of NOS-immunoreactive endothelial cells in umbilical artery and vein from late pregnancy was 3 and 10 per cent, respectively. These results suggest that nitric oxide contributes little, if any, to the local control of umbilical blood flow throughout pregnancy, despite the presence of NOS-immunoreactivity in a subpopulation of endothelial cells in late pregnancy.

摘要

人脐血管没有神经,因此内皮细胞可能在胎儿 - 胎盘血流控制中发挥重要作用。在本研究中,我们检测了多种已知能在许多血管中产生内皮介导的血管舒张作用的物质,对来自合法终止妊娠(平均孕周15(8 - 17)周;n = 12)和足月阴道分娩(平均孕周39(38 - 41)周;n = 12)的人脐动脉和静脉的药理作用。乙酰胆碱、5'-三磷酸腺苷、钙离子载体A23187和P物质对升高的血管张力没有影响,而硝普钠可使早孕期和晚孕期5 - 羟色胺(5 - HT)预收缩的脐动脉和静脉舒张。L - 硝基精氨酸甲酯(L - NAME)对基础张力或5 - HT升高后的高张力均无影响。使用电子免疫细胞化学方法在相同的脐血管中检测一氧化氮合酶[NOS,I型(神经元型)]的定位。在早孕期获取的脐血管中未观察到NOS免疫反应性内皮细胞。然而,晚孕期脐动脉和静脉中NOS免疫反应性内皮细胞的百分比分别为3%和10%。这些结果表明,尽管晚孕期内皮细胞亚群中存在NOS免疫反应性,但一氧化氮在整个孕期对脐血流的局部控制作用甚微(如果有作用的话)。
